Transaction 1137569b1599f34075cbdd944aad8e26f42bef198ea0786bb6492ed36995efb5

1 Input
2 Outputs
  • 1137569b1599f34075cbdd944aad8e26f42bef198ea0786bb6492ed36995efb5:0
  • value  5180513
    address  3BB9i2HSCCvwWzDk5jDcH4Nu8pw6AgDGMA
  • 1137569b1599f34075cbdd944aad8e26f42bef198ea0786bb6492ed36995efb5:1
  • value  189848786
    address  19U2gjwRpNT1BhL741vEgSDHoMGTvgvW7J